Delaware is a state in the Mid-Atlantic region of the United States, bordering Maryland to its south and west; Pennsylvania to its north; and New Jersey and the Atlantic Ocean to its east. WebDelaware (/ ˈ d ɛ l ə w ɛər / ()) is a state in the United States.It is sometimes called the First State because it was the first colony to accept the new constitution in 1787. Its capital is Dover and its biggest city is Wilmington.It is the second smallest state in the United States. The Dutch first settled Delaware. The Swedish then took over in the mid-1600s.
